Cheapest Available Canyon and Nearby 1 Bedroom Apartments

As of April 23, 2025 the lowest priced 1 Bedroom apartment unit in Canyon, MN is the 1BR/1.0BA Model starting from $1,200 at 521 W 2nd Street - Leijona in the Duluth Heights neighborhood. The second most affordable Canyon 1 Bedroom is the 1 Bedroom Market Rate Model at Village Place Apartments starting at $1,250 in the East End neighborhood. The average price for all 1 Bedroom apartments in Canyon is currently $1,607.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available 1 Bedroom options in Canyon:

Quick Rent Budget Calculator

How much rent can you afford?

The common "Rule of Thumb" is that rent should be no more than 30% of your income. How much is that? Enter your monthly income and click "Calculate My Budget" to find out.
